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Boa tarde galera.
Estou desenvolvendo uma solução onde alguns clientes irão conectar em um WebService que fica em meu servidor.
Gostaria de umas opniões sobre a seguinte questão: devo deixar um banco de dados apenas com todas as informações (na verdade está assim hoje), ou desmembro ele em um banco para cada Cliente.
Fiz a aplicação com o MSSQL 2014 Express, estou até pensando em migrar ele para um outro SGDB free, devido a demanda que o sistema esta tento, e a licença do SQL está um absurdo hoje em dia.
Seu eu separar em um banco por cliente dificilmente o banco alcançaria os limites, já por outro lado, como um servidor com o SQL Express se comportaria com diversos (50 por exemplo) bancos de dados?
Se for optar por migrar para outro SGDB, qual tem recursos descentes (Replicação, Backup DIferencial, etc) MySQL, Postgres, Firebird, DB2 Express-C, de serem utilizados em risco de corromper (Firebird com replicação tem uma reputação de corromper muito :upset: ).
:natalbiggrin: O DB2 Express-C, alguém trabalhou com ele em produção? Sem limite de espaço, 2 processadores 4 de RAM.
Para rodar de maneira aceitável qual sua configuração ideal?
PS: Sou fã do MSSQL..........
Agradeço as considerações de quem puder dar uma ideia.
:yes:
Carregando comentários...